Linux集群搭建1之-ssh免密登陆与远程复制

1、集群搭建之前,先给虚拟机拍摄快照和机器克隆。
2、远程登录进行操作指令的时候都要输入密码,可以设置ssh免密登陆。
3、免密机制:(1)在机器上生成秘钥;(2)将公钥发给需要免密操作的机器。(机器可以是其他虚拟机,也可以是远程连接的机器)
4、两种安全验证机制:(1)用户名和密码;(2)公钥和私钥机制。
Linux集群搭建1之-ssh免密登陆与远程复制
5、实现步骤:
(1)每台机器上安装ssh的客户端:
yum list | grep ssh 查找ssh命令;
yum -y install openssh
yum -y install openssh-clients
(2)ssh-****** 生成公钥
(3)ssh-copy-id linux02 发送公钥给其他机器
(4)ssh linux02 测试是否连接成功
6、公钥位置:
vi /root/.ssh/authorized-keys
当需要克隆新的机器时,克隆之前,先找到.ssh文件,删掉,再重新生成,重新分发。
7、远程复制:(远程scp 前提是两台机器都要安装了ssh的客户端 )
配置免密连接:
Scp ./1.txt linux02:/root/ 拷贝的是文件
Scp -r ./a/ 192.168.33.4:/root/ 拷贝的是文件夹
远程复制hostname信息(节省重新设置的时间):
scp /etc/hosts linux02:/etc./